Soyuz TM-17

USSR


Manned Flight nº: 162

Earth orbit Flight nº: 159

USSR Flight nº: 77


Launch & orbit data:

Designation 22704 / 93043A
Launch date - time 01 Jul 1993 - 14:32:58 UT
Launch site Baikonur, LC1
Launch vehicle  Soyuz 11A511U2
OKB name - S/Nº Soyuz 7K-STM (11F732) s/nº 66.
Mass (kg) 7150
Call Sign Sirius
Earth orbit on :
   - Perigee / Apogee 388 x 397 km
   - Inclination 51.6°
   - Period 92.4 min

Docking & landing data:

Docking date - time 03 Jul 1993 - 16:24:03 UT
Target spacecraft/port Mir/fore
Undocking date - time 14 Jan 1994 - 04:37:11
(collided with fore twice)
Deorbit burn date - time 14 Jan 1994 - 07:23:46 UT
separate 07:51:52 UT
Landing date - time 14 Jan 1994 - 08:18:20 UT
Landing location 215 km W of Karaganda
(49° 37' N, 70° 7' E)
Flight Duration (d:hr:min) 196d 17hr 45m
Nbr orbits 
Landing crew Tsibliyev, Serebrov
 (crew TM-17)

Launch Crew (EO-14):

Nr. Surname Given name Job Duration Orbits
1  Tsibliyev  Vasili Vasiliyevich  Commander 196d 17h 45m  3113 
2  Serebrov  Aleksandr Aleksandrovich  Flight engineer 196d 17h 45m  3113 
3  Haigneré  Jean-Pierre  Research cosmonaut 20d 16h 08m  327 

Haigneré landed with Soyuz TM-16 on 22 Jul 1993
